Justin-Bieber Early Life

On March 1, 1994, in London, Ontario, Bieber entered the world. Bieber was raised by his mother’s grandmother and step-grandfather because his parents never married and she was a minor at the time of his birth. As a child, he took lessons on multiple instruments, including the piano, drums, guitar, and trumpet. In 2012, he earned his diploma from St. Michael Catholic Secondary School in Stratford, Ontario.

Bieber sang “So Sick” by Ne-Yo at a local Stratford singing competition when he was 12 years old, and he came in second. His mother recorded the show and uploaded it on YouTube so that Bieber’s friends and family could watch it, and she has since uploaded other videos of him performing cover songs.

Justin Bieber: What Is Ramsay Hunt Syndrome, the Condition Affecting the Singer?

Postponing scheduled performance appearances, Justin Bieber contracted a viral virus that paralyzed one side of his face, forcing him to cancel them. Justin Bieber told his Instagram fans in a video that “this eye is not blinking.” My smile does not appear on this side of my face. That nose can’t move a muscle.

The 28-year-old Canadian musician has Ramsay Hunt syndrome. Varicella-zoster virus, the same virus that causes chickenpox, is to blame. After a person recovers from chickenpox, the virus can lie latent in their system for decades. In most cases, it can be found in the dorsal root ganglion, a collection of nerve cells that sits just below the spinal column. In its dormant state, the virus causes no noticeable symptoms.

Certain people experience a resurgence of symptoms. This might happen spontaneously or as a result of a known trigger such as stress, a previous infection (particularly COVID-19), a damaged immune system, or another sickness. The varicella virus can become active again and transmit the disease because all of these circumstances compromise immune system function.

The painful rash and blisters of shingles appear in one location on the body when the virus reactivates (commonly the torso). However, when this reactivation involves the facial nerve, a nerve in the head, we call it Ramsay Hunt syndrome, after the doctor who first described it in 1907.

Five out of every 100,000 people are diagnosed with Ramsey Hunt syndrome each year, but everyone who has had chickenpox is at risk.
